In his book The Imperative of Responsibility, the philosopher Hans Jonas—who wrote his doctoral dissertation under Martin Heidegger but later repudiated his mentor—describes the profound transformation that modern technology has brought about in man’s relationship with nature. The Greeks, he says, were quite capable of praising humanity’s powers to transform the natural environment, but those powers remained within sharp limits. Our inroads into nature were essentially superficial. There was harmony in the end because human activity left the encompassing nature fundamentally unchanged. At most, it scratched the surface.
A 1936 Speech Offers Dire Warnings for Today

Haile Selassie had few weapons but warned Europe of the doom that followed.
At first, the speaker solemnly recounted, the invading aircraft dropped tear gas bombs but the “soldiers learned to scatter, waiting until the wind had rapidly dispersed the poisonous gas.”
Adjusting their tactics, the aircraft then dropped barrels of mustard gas. The barrels would rupture upon impact, but the poisonous effect was limited. So, for more efficient delivery, “Special sprayers were installed on board aircraft so that they could vaporize, over vast areas of territory, a fine, death-dealing rain.”

Fact-checking Russian claims about Bucha killings

After Russian troops withdrew from the town on the outskirts of Kyiv, images of bodies lying in the streets subsequently emerged and members of media organisations also saw corpses.
Ukraine accused Russia of a “deliberate massacre” but Russia called it “a staged provocation by the Kiev regime”. It made a series of unfounded claims about the footage from Bucha.
After the Russian withdrawal, footage taken from a car as it drove through the town showed bodies on either side of the road.
Pro-Russian social media accounts then circulated a slowed-down version of the video, claiming that the arm on one of the bodies moved.

Russia’s Bucha “Facts” Versus the Evidence
Recent images from the town of Bucha just outside Kyiv, captured as Ukrainian forces regained ground following the retreat of Russian forces, show widespread destruction and corpses in civilians clothes strewn across streets.
These images have been shared on social media and broadcast by members of the international press who have visited the town in recent days.
Initial reports from human rights organisations on the actions of Russian forces have detailed violence targeting civilians. Interviews with local residents, meanwhile, have accused Russian troops of carrying out summary executions of unarmed men over suspicions they had fought for Ukrainian armed forces in the Donbas in 2014, or even “simply for having a tattoo of Ukraine’s national emblem”.

Thank you very much for your support. I’ve just noticed your letter in my mailbox.
In main , we are doing fine. I know that you phone to my mother regularly. So you know how are they doing. As russian troops go back from Kyiv region to Belarus, it’s comparatively quiet in Baryshivka region. But people say that russians left explosives and mines in every village or town they stayed in, so it’s still dangerous to come back there.
Probably you’ve already seen all those horrible photos of Bucha after russians ran out of it. They even had mobile crematorium to burn out bodies of civil people to hide their’s crimes. I have no words to describe my desperate…
My former colleague and her daughter were hostages for 5 days near Kyiv . They were forced to seat in a very small basement of their private house. Russians came into a little village with tanks and other military armor. They took all the money women had and told them to stay in the basement. Here in Ukraine our basements are not the same as your’s in Canada. It’s a really cold place under the ground. People use to keep there potatoes, carrots and other vegetables from their gardens during whole winter. There is no water or heat or toilet down there. Usually there are no windows also. So poor women lived in such awful conditions while russians stayed in their house. Russians dug a big whole in the backyard and parked tank there to hide it from Ukrainian solgers. All days long the tank was shooting above the heads of women. I can imagine the terrible roar. After couple of days russians brought 5 people from the neighbor housies and put them into the basement of my colleague. They were women and elderly people with health problems. Russians took away all the phones so poor women couldn’t call for help or to get any information about the situation in their region. My colleague told that russians were drunk and aggressive almost all the time. On one of that moments of aggression one of the senior officers came down to the basement and decided to scare his hostages even more – he interrogated them very roughly and in the end he shot 2 people just in the eyes of poor women…. and left bodies in the basement so everyone left alive have to live near the dead bodies… I talked with my colleague by the phone after she was saved from this hell. She said that she think she is out of her mind and she can not be normal adequate person after this. She is over 70 and her daughter is over 40. And the most unbelievable thing is that they were saved just thanks to one of the russians private. He came to them and said that he didn’t want to come to this war and wanted to help them. On that day there was green corridor arranged in the region and the russian private let people escape from the basement. Now women are in Lviv on the western Ukraine.
This history is one of the hundreds , thousands. And I really don’t know if I can ever hear or read all of them because any normal psyche can not hold this horror out.
Me and my sister decided to stay wherever we are till the situation is pretty good in our regions. For now the region is quiet but almost every day and night we here air raid sirens. Only this sounds can drive one crazy, I assure you. But we’re still hoping, we’re still working and still waiting for peace.
